What Features Come with the 2026 Mercedes-Benz E-Class Wagon Trims?
The 2026 Mercedes-Benz E 450 4MATIC® All-Terrain Wagon is designed for drivers who value comfort, versatility, and year-round confidence. Powered by a 3.6-liter turbocharged six-cylinder engine with mild-hybrid technology, it offers smooth acceleration and refined efficiency. Standard 4MATIC® all-wheel drive and adjustable AIRMATIC® suspension provide stability on changing road surfaces while maintaining a comfortable ride.
Inside, passengers enjoy premium materials, with heated and ventilated front seats available as options. You will find the latest 3rd-generation MBUX infotainment system with wireless Apple CarPlay® and Android Auto® integration for an excellent driving experience. A spacious cargo area and flexible rear seating make it an excellent companion for family adventures and daily commuting alike. As far as safety goes, Mercedes-Benz offers advanced driver-assistance technology, including ATTENTION ASSIST®, Blind Spot Assist with Exit Warning Assist, Brake Assist (BAS), and more.

Meanwhile, the 2026 Mercedes-Benz AMG® E 53 HYBRID Wagon raises performance to another level. Its plug-in hybrid powertrain combines an AMG®-enhanced turbocharged engine with electric assistance for rapid acceleration and impressive responsiveness. AMG®-tuned suspension, performance brakes, and dynamic driving modes create an engaging driving experience without sacrificing practicality.
The cabin features heated front seats with heated rear seats as an option, making your drive comfortable. Additionally, you will find AMG®-specific displays, premium trim finishes, and advanced digital technology. Drivers also benefit from sophisticated safety systems, premium audio options, and a luxurious interior designed for spirited journeys.

What Are the Differences Between the 2026 Mercedes-Benz E-Class Wagon Trims?
If you’re wondering how the 2026 Mercedes-Benz E-Class Wagon trims compare, the biggest difference lies in their personalities. The E 450 4MATIC® All-Terrain Wagon emphasizes comfort, versatility, and confident all-weather capability. It is ideal for families, long-distance travelers, and drivers seeking luxury with added practicality.
By comparison, the AMG® E 53 HYBRID Wagon targets enthusiasts who want sports car performance with everyday usability. Its plug-in hybrid system delivers greater power, sharper handling, and exclusive AMG® styling inside and out. Although both models offer premium technology, advanced safety features, and spacious interiors, the AMG® version provides a more performance-focused driving experience. At the same time, the All-Terrain Wagon prioritizes ride comfort and utility.
